    The 6.2 L (379 cu in) V8 is the main variant of the Boss engine. The V8 shares design similarities with the Modular Engine family such as a deep-skirt block with cross-bolted main caps, crankshaft-driven gerotor oil pump, overhead cam valve train arrangement, and bellhousing bolt pattern.

    The largest displacement version of the Essex V6 appeared in the 1997 model year as a replacement for the Ford 300 straight six in the F-150. This engine kept the 3.8 L's bore, but featured a stroke lengthened to 95 mm (3.74 in), bringing its displacement up to 4,195 cc (256.0 cu in).
